When the Grand Cherokee’s onboard diagnostics system (OBD-II) detects a fault in the EVAP system via a vacuum test, it generates the P0440 code. This code is a general indication of a malfunction in the EVAP system and does not pinpoint the specific problem. It is common for another code from the P044X series to accompany the P0440 code
